About Lipiodol Ultra Fluide 10 Ml Injection
Lipiodol Ultra Fluide 10 mL Injection is a radiopaque contrast medium used in medical imaging, particularly in radiology and interventional procedures. It contains ethiodized oil as the active ingredient, which is a specialized contrast agent used to enhance the visibility of internal structures during imaging.
Key Details about Lipiodol Ultra Fluide 10 mL Injection:
Active Ingredient:
- Ethiodized Oil (Lipiodol Ultra Fluide): A highly purified form of iodine-based oil used as a contrast agent in radiologic imaging.
Common Uses:
- Hysterosalpingography (HSG): Lipiodol Ultra Fluide is used in hysterosalpingography, a radiographic procedure performed to examine the uterus and fallopian tubes. It is injected into the uterine cavity and fallopian tubes to help visualize blockages or abnormalities.
- Selective Internal Radiation Therapy (SIRT): It is used in interventional radiology for transarterial chemoembolization (TACE) or selective internal radiation therapy (SIRT), particularly in treating liver cancer (hepatocellular carcinoma). Lipiodol is used to deliver chemotherapy drugs directly into the liver tumor and embolize the blood supply to the tumor.
- Lymphography: Lipiodol is used for lymphangiography, a procedure to visualize the lymphatic system. The injection helps to highlight lymph nodes and vessels during imaging to assess any lymphatic system abnormalities or blockages.
- Endovenous Use: It can be used in the treatment of certain types of varicose veins, as it helps to enhance the visibility of veins in certain imaging procedures.
Mechanism of Action:
- Radiopaque Contrast: Lipiodol Ultra Fluide contains iodine, which absorbs X-rays. This makes it appear white or bright on radiographs (X-rays) and fluoroscopic images, helping to highlight certain anatomical structures during diagnostic imaging.
- Selective Delivery: In interventional radiology procedures like TACE or SIRT, Lipiodol aids in the precise delivery of chemotherapy drugs or radiation particles to the tumor site while blocking the tumor's blood supply.
Administration:
- Injection: Lipiodol Ultra Fluide is administered intravenously, intra-arterially, or intra-cavity depending on the type of imaging or procedure being performed.
- The injection is typically given under the supervision of an experienced radiologist or interventional radiologist during a clinical imaging procedure.
Side Effects:
- Common Side Effects:
- Injection site reactions: Pain, swelling, or redness at the site of injection.
- Allergic reactions: Rash, itching, or fever (though rare, some patients may experience an allergic reaction).
- Nausea and vomiting: Occasional side effects after the procedure.
- Metallic taste: Some patients may experience a metallic taste during or after the injection.
- Serious Side Effects (Rare but possible):
- Anaphylactic reactions: Though very rare, some individuals may experience severe allergic reactions, including difficulty breathing, swelling, or low blood pressure.
- Renal toxicity: In rare cases, there may be adverse effects on kidney function, especially if the patient has pre-existing kidney conditions.
- Thyroid dysfunction: The iodine in Lipiodol may cause thyroid-related issues in some cases, especially if used repeatedly.
- Extravasation: If the contrast agent leaks outside of the target area, it may cause irritation or tissue damage.
Precautions:
- Kidney Function: Lipiodol should be used with caution in patients with impaired kidney function, as it may contribute to further renal problems. Adequate hydration before and after the procedure is often recommended.
- Pregnancy and Breastfeeding: Lipiodol should generally be avoided during pregnancy and breastfeeding unless absolutely necessary. If used, a physician may recommend stopping breastfeeding temporarily to avoid exposure to the infant.
- Iodine Sensitivity: Patients with a known allergy to iodine or previous reactions to contrast media should inform their healthcare provider before using Lipiodol.
- Radiation Sensitivity: Since Lipiodol is used in X-ray and fluoroscopy procedures, patients should minimize unnecessary exposure to radiation. It is important to follow radiation safety protocols during procedures.
Storage:
- Store Lipiodol Ultra Fluide at room temperature (away from heat or direct sunlight).
- Keep it in its original packaging until use, and do not freeze.
- Ensure that the vial is intact before use, and do not use it if it appears damaged or expired.
Contraindications:
- Known allergy to iodine-based contrast agents.
- Severe liver dysfunction in certain cases where liver imaging or liver-directed therapies are not appropriate.
- Severe renal insufficiency without appropriate renal function monitoring.
